我直接去/System/Library/Java/JavaVirtualMachines/
把1.6的那个文件夹删了不会出什么问题吗?
我直接去/System/Library/Java/JavaVirtualMachines/
把1.6的那个文件夹删了不会出什么问题吗?
java理论上是向后兼容的,所以大部分软件是可以运行的,那么实际情况呢?
比如有的项目依赖Oracle Jdk中的sun.misc.Unsafe类,那么高版本就不一定兼容低版本,甚至Java 9中将移除 Sun.misc.Unsafe
8 回答6.4k 阅读
1 回答4.1k 阅读✓ 已解决
3 回答2.3k 阅读✓ 已解决
2 回答3.2k 阅读
2 回答3.9k 阅读
1 回答2.2k 阅读✓ 已解决
3 回答1.6k 阅读✓ 已解决
要看会不会用到jdk1.6喽
例如webstorm8就需要1.6的JDK才可运行,高版本的JDK还不行的